Overview of internal control parameters
The internal control compares the setpoint value with the outlet
temperature and calculates the control value, i.e. the amount to be
heated or cooled.
The following control parameters can be adjusted for the
internal control:
Parameter Description Unit
Xp Proportional range K
Tn Reset time s
Tv Lead time s
Td Damping time s
If Tv manual/auto
is set to auto , Tv and Td cannot be
changed. In this case, they are derived with fixed factors
from Tn.
The temperature limits Tih and Til also influence the
control.

Adjusting internal control parameters
Personnel:
Operating personnel
1.
Select the menu item Control parameter intern Pt1000 in
the Control menu.
2. Select one of the following options:
You can select any of the listed control parameters.
With Tv manual/auto , you can define whether the control
parameters Tv
and Td are set manually or automati-
cally. If the automatic setting is active, both control
parameters are displayed with a padlock and cannot be
selected. In this case, they are derived with fixed factors
from Tn .
